Need advice on how to remove lower balljoint
Like the title says, I'm looking for some tips on how to remove the lower ball joint from the knuckle assembly on my car (97 2.2).. I have rented a balljoint press kit from the local parts store but the damn thing doesn't fit well on my car... Is there anyother way to get that sucker out? I tried to hammer it out a little without success....

I used the press tool to install the new ball joint w/ the lower end of clamp pressing the base of the ball joint and a large socket or tube for a receiver/spacer on lower side of knuckle. Once everything was snugged, I restrained the knuckle/assy in a vise to allow turning press drive bolt w/ a breaker bar. It probably took 100-120 ft-lbs to turn the press drive bolt.

I rented a press kit to install the new one in. I didn't have to remove the knuckle assembly from the car or anything. I put some anti seize on the side of the ball joint and cleaned the hole real good and it went in very easily, didn't even have to break out the power bar...
